What does a cock ring do?
A cock ring—also called a penis ring—gently constricts the base of the penis (and sometimes the testicles). This slows blood out-flow, helping you stay harder for longer and boosting sensation for both partners. Vibrating models add extra clitoral or perineal stimulation, turning every thrust into a shared thrill.
Which types of cock rings can I try?
· tretchy Silicone Rings – soft, beginner-friendly, slip on and off easily.
· Adjustable Strap Rings – Velcro or snap fasteners let you fine-tune tightness.
· Vibrating Cock Rings – built-in motor delivers 7-10 speeds for dual pleasure.
· Dual-Ring Designs – one loop for the shaft, one for the testicles to increase staying power.
· Rigid Metal Rings – stainless-steel or aluminum for firm pressure and temperature play (advanced users only).
How do I choose the right cock ring?
1. Measure first: Wrap a soft tape around the base when semi-erect; divide by 3.14 to find diameter.
2. Match material to comfort: Silicone for flexibility, metal for firmness, ABS + silicone for vibro models.
3. Check features: Rechargeable motor? Remote control? Waterproof rating for shower play?
4. Budget: Quality silicone rings start under $15; smart-app vibrating rings range $40-$80.
5. Skill level: Beginners start with stretchy or adjustable styles; move up when you’re confident with fit and removal.
How do I use a cock ring safely?
1. Lube up: Apply water-based lube to the shaft and inside of the ring.
2. Slide it on: Position at the base before you’re fully hard; adjust so it feels snug, not tight.
3. Time limit: Wear no longer than 20–30 minutes per session to avoid numbness.
4. During play: If using a condom, put the condom on first; if vibration, start on low and increase gradually.
5. Remove & clean: Take off immediately if you feel discomfort; wash with warm water and toy cleaner, then air-dry.
Can cock rings enhance partner play?
Yes. A vibrating ring can massage a partner’s clitoris or perineum during penetration, while a dual-ring model adds extra pressure for the wearer. Remote-controlled rings let your partner decide the rhythm—perfect for playful power exchange.
